CPAN Modules review

  • @thibaultduponchelle - Reviewing Filter::Crypto and public CPAN module using it
    • @thibaultduponchelle @giterlizzi - Investigated functioning of Filter::Crypto
    • Encrypted module on CPAN - the author removed the encryption in the new version
    • cpansec recommends an update to the PAUSE rules to prohibit: 1. encrypted modules, 2. malware, 3. undocumented “phone home” etc.
      • @robrwo puts together a proposal for PAUSE rules - review other ecosystems
    • @stigtsp & @robrwo - Contacted author of a CPAN module and PAUSE admins - action taken
    • @thibaultduponchelle @robrwo and group - Agreed on policy - “Indecipherable blobs should not be allowed to be part of public CPAN upload”
    • @sjn - Only one consumer of Filter::Crypto - now 0 (as of 4 June 2025)
  • Net::CIDR::Set taken over by @robrwo and patch submitted

CNA & Vulnerability Index

CNA Organization

  • @stigtsp, issue with bounded max versions in CVE records (Mojolicious, cpanminus)
    • Issues updating MITRE issued CVEs
    • long standing vulnerabilities are a problem
  • @stigtsp, Red Hat is discussing adoption of pre CNA CVEs with CNA Root Board, after MITRE rejected our request to adopt old in-scope CVEs
    • Rejected by mitre
    • will be raised at the board meeting of CVEs
  • @stigtsp, @timlegge - Presentation of CNA work so far
    • @stigtsp - 30 CVE identifiers reserved, and 24 published in our database, per now
  • @stigtsp - We need more help from others in the triage group:
    • Contact @timlegge, @stigtsp - Analysing vulnerabilities
    • Contact @timlegge, @stigtsp - Integrating CVE process more with triage
  • @robrwo - CNA/CPANSec workflow description needed from CVE reservation to disclosure
    • (Volunteer needed) - Write a guide/workflow doc, including details on how embargoes work
    • @sjn - could this be turned into a tabletop exercise?
  • @stigtsp - guided CVE writeup-sessions at PTS and at regular times otherwise
    • @stigtsp and @timlegge prepare a dummy scenario
  • @stigtsp - Tried to reach out to ENISA (EUVD) now a couple of times to discuss contingency/options, but no answer yet.
    • @sjn had a meeting coming up and will ask
      • Comms folk are super busy, please give them more time; It’s also ok to send a reminder.
  • @stigtsp - @garu has emailed a list of old perl CVEs to RH for reassignment to our CNA, pending
    • mitre declined
  • @stigtsp - Can someone look at the cpansa-feed, it’s broken for a while now :-(
    • - @stigtsp will try to look at this Soon™
  • @robrwo asked on Matrix about ways to track issues to triage/research before CVEs

Secure by Default

TLS/HTTPS/CSPRNG/DSA in core

  • @leont - share ongoings & blockers
    • @leont - a minimal XS wrapper around libopenssl
    • @toddr - should we explore simpler options, like wrapping libcurl? or even calling /usr/bin/curl
      • @toddr - some license issues to be aware of (which is another argument to “Just use curl(1)”)
  • no update since PTS
